What You Will Do
  • Perform accurate Country of Origin (COO) determinations based on manufacturing process, supplier data, and applicable regulations.
  • Apply Rules of Origin (ROO) and Substantial Transformation concepts to evaluate origin status.
  • Interpret and implement Preferential and Non-Preferential Rules of Origin for various countries and trade agreements (e.g., USMCA, EU, ASEAN, RCEP, etc.).
  • Classify materials using the Harmonized Tariff Schedule (HTS) and understand its connection to origin determination.
  • Validate and maintain supplier origin declarations, certificates of origin, and other supporting documentation.
  • Support FTA eligibility analysis and maintain compliance records for audit readiness.
  • Assist in internal trade compliance audits and provide data/documentation as required.
  • Stay updated on global trade regulation changes related to rules of origin and HTS updates.
